A Journey Down the Yellow Brick Road
The Wizard of Oz is a masterful adaptation of L. Frank Baum’s classic novel, with a talented cast that brings the characters to life in a way that continues to delight audiences today. The film follows Dorothy (Judy Garland), a young girl from Kansas who is swept away by a tornado to the magical Land of Oz. Alongside her loyal dog Toto, Dorothy embarks on a journey down the Yellow Brick Road, encountering a cast of colorful characters including the Scarecrow, Tin Man, and Cowardly Lion.
The Magic of Technicolor
One of the most striking aspects of The Wizard of Oz is its groundbreaking use of Technicolor. This innovative film technology brought a level of vibrancy and depth to the screen that was unlike anything audiences had ever seen before. From the bright red slippers to the emerald green trees, every frame of this film is a feast for the eyes.
A Star is Born: Judy Garland
Judy Garland’s performance as Dorothy Gale is nothing short of iconic. Her rendition of “Over the Rainbow” is a highlight of the film, showcasing her incredible vocal talents and capturing the hearts of audiences worldwide. Garland’s portrayal of Dorothy is both endearing and relatable, making it easy for viewers to become invested in her journey.
A Legacy that Endures
The Wizard of Oz has left an indelible mark on popular culture, with its themes of friendship, perseverance, and self-discovery continuing to resonate with audiences today. This film’s influence can be seen in everything from musicals like Wicked to films like The Muppet Movie, cementing its place as one of the greatest films of all time.
